
The holiday weekend has been devastating for the Bear River Lake Resort after losing its entire lodge to a fire early Sunday morning. Everyone was able to get out safely, but the loss is affecting campers who see it as their own community, according to ABC10.
They’re crediting the quick work of Amador (Calif.) firefighters and a recent soaking rain as the reasons the surrounding trees didn’t catch fire and make things much worse.
Ashes and burnt objects are all that’s left of the popular resort lodge.
“(We’ve) never had anything like this happen to us before. I feel like our 30 years is down the drain,” said Bear River Lake Resort co-owner Janette Frazier.
Frazier has poured her heart and soul into the campgrounds for decades. It took a matter of minutes around 2 a.m. Sunday for it to be destroyed.
